Developed by: UKCPA Women's Health Committee
This masterclass will focus on issues predominant in women on maternity wards as well as menopause care in clinics and outpatients settings. Pregnancy patients coming to hospital often present with a variety of challenges, including diabetes, hypertension, or other complications. As a pharmacist you are optimally placed to intervene for the benefit of your patients and manage medication risks.
This event is suitable for pharmacists who have recently specialised as well as those who are working at early advanced levels and will be of particular benefit to pharmacists involved in providing and developing services in maternity and menopause looking after patients during the course of their reproductive life in secondary and primary care.
The aim of this masterclass is to provide the required knowledge and skills for pharmacists who are practising or involved in the care of patients during pregnancy and the menopause.
